titleOfInvention | Hydrophilic copolymer, process for producing same, photosensitive composition, and photosensitive rubber plate |
abstract | A photosensitive composition is provided, which comprises (A) 20 - 65 wt. parts of an elastomer, (B) 35 - 80 wt. parts of a hydrophilic copolymer consisting essentially of, based on the weight of the copolymer, (1) 1 - 30 wt.% of units of a phosphorus-, boron- or sulfur-containing monoethylenically unsaturated monomer, (2) 0.5 - 25 wt.% of units of a phosphorus-, boron- or sulfur-containing diethylenically unsaturated monomer, (3) 40 - 90 wt.% of units of a conjugated diene monomer, and (4) 0 - 58.5 wt.% of units of other copolymerizable monomer; the total amount of (A) plus (B) being 100 wt. parts, (C) 5 - 100 wt. parts of a photopolymerizable ethylenically unsaturated monomer, and (D) 0.1 - 10 wt. parts of a photopolymerization initiator. The photosensitive composition is useful for the preparation of a flexographic printing plate. |
